Manual steering box rebuild
I'm on round 2 rebuilding this thing due to improper seal install last time.
A few years ago the upper bearing failed and the worm gear came out. I was able to find replacement seals locally. However when I spoke on the phone to *redacted* and explained my situation I was raked over the coals and paid a whole lot of Canadian peso's for a bearing cage and a few ball bearings. He didn't even give me the outer race. So, has anybody ever found replacement bearings? From what I can tell the inner race is lathed into the inner-shaft and only one of the outer race is easily replaced. So using a modern roller bearing is not really an option. Seals I can source but I need another cage. Anybody have a lead on a rebuild kit? or just the parts I need? |
